U E D R , A S I H C RSS

VM Ware/Useful Functions



1. VMWare 유용한 기능들

VMWare 는 크로스 컴파일링 환경에서 유용한 기능을 몇가지 가지고 있다. 물론 해당 가상 머신에 VMWare Tools 라는 VMWARE 가 제공하는 프로그램을 올렸을 경우에만 작동한다.
가상 머신이 리눅스이고 VMWARE TOOL 의 바이너리와 호환성을 갖지 못한다면 커널 드라이버를 컴파일 해서 설치해야함. (물론 VMWARE 설치 스크립트가 알아서 해줌, 우분투 DD 에서는 정상동작 하지 않았음. 데비안, 페도라 사용 가능함.)

2. Shared Folder

가상 머신과 호스트 머신 사이에 데이터를 옮기는 방법은 여러가지를 생각할 수 있다. 가장 많이 이용하는 방법은 NAT 로 구성된 가상 머신상의 네트웍 기능을 이용하여 FTP 로 전송하는 방법을 가장 많이 생각 할 수 있다.
하지만 이 쉐어드 폴더 기능을 이용하면 VMWARE 수준에서 호스트 머신의 특정 디렉토리를 리눅스의 FS 에 마운팅 하는 것이 가능하다.

/mnt/hgfs/

하단에 마운팅이 되며, NTFS 직접 마운팅과 달리 VMWARE 드라이버를 한단계 거쳐서 들어가기 때문에 정상적이니 파일의 입력, 출력이 모두 가능하다.
즉 윈도우 시스템의 IDE 를 이용해 프로그래밍하고 VMWARE 호스트 머신에서 컴파일 하는 과정을 최대한 간단하게 만드는 방법이 이 VMWARE TOOLS 을 이용하는 것이다.
Valid XHTML 1.0! Valid CSS! powered by MoniWiki
last modified 2009-05-27 07:09:19
Processing time 0.0098 sec